Preparing the Oven and Glaze for Hot Honey Feta Chicken

First, turn your oven to 400 degrees Fahrenheit. That’s 200 degrees Celsius if you use metric. Lightly grease your baking dish now. In a small bowl, mix your hot honey glaze. Combine honey, chili paste, and pepper flakes well.

Seasoning and Initial Bake

Pat your chicken breasts totally dry with paper towels. Rub them lightly with olive oil. Sprinkle salt and pepper onto both sides. Place the seasoned chicken in your dish. Brush just half of that lovely glaze over the tops.

Now, pop it into the hot oven. Let it bake undisturbed for fifteen minutes. This starts the cooking process nicely.

Finishing the Hot Honey Feta Chicken

Carefully pull the dish out of the oven. Brush the remaining glaze over the chicken pieces. Next, sprinkle that crumbled feta cheese evenly on top. Return the dish to the oven again. Bake until the internal temp hits 165 Fahrenheit. That usually takes ten to fifteen more minutes.

Resting and Serving Hot Honey Feta Chicken

This step is critical, don’t skip it! Let the chicken rest for five minutes. This lets the juices redistribute inside. Finally, garnish with fresh chopped parsley. Serve immediately for the best taste!

Can I make this Hot Honey Feta Chicken ahead of time?

Yes, you absolutely can prep ahead! You can mix the hot honey glaze days before. Store it covered in the fridge. You can even cook the baked chicken fully. Then, cool it down completely. Reheat gently later on. It reheats well for quick lunches.

What is the best way to check if my baked chicken is done?

Visual checks are okay, but thermometers are best. Always use a meat thermometer. Insert it into the thickest part of the chicken. The internal temperature must reach 165 degrees Fahrenheit. This guarantees safety and perfect texture. Checking food safety temperatures is crucial.

Can I substitute the feta cheese?

Feta brings that unique salty tang. However, goat cheese is a nice swap. It melts similarly creamy. If you prefer less salt, try ricotta cheese instead. It will be milder in flavor, though.

Description

Create a fantastic weeknight dinner with this Baked Hot Honey Feta Chicken. You get a perfect blend of sweet honey, spicy heat, and creamy, salty feta. This recipe is simple to prepare and delivers gourmet flavor fast.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 4 Boneless, skinless chicken breasts
  • 1/2 cup Honey
  • 2 tablespoons Sriracha or chili paste
  • 1 teaspoon Red pepper flakes
  • 1/2 teaspoon Sal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on Black pepper
  • 8 ounces Feta cheese, crumbled
  • 1 tablespoon Olive oil
  •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)


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 400 degrees Fahrenheit (200 degrees Celsius). Lightly grease a baking dish.
  2. In a small bowl, mix the honey, Sriracha, and red pepper flakes to create the hot honey glaze. Set aside.
  3. Pat the chicken breasts dry. Rub them lightly with olive oil and season with salt and pepper. Place the chicken in the prepared baking dish.
  4. Brush half of the hot honey glaze evenly over the tops of the chicken breasts.
  5. Bake for 15 minutes.
  6. Remove the dish from the oven. Brush the remaining glaze over the chicken. Sprinkle the crumbled feta cheese evenly over each piece.
  7. Return the chicken to the oven and bake for another 10-15 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through (internal temperature reaches 165 degrees Fahrenheit) and the feta is slightly softened and lightly golden.
  8. Let the chicken rest for 5 minutes before serving. Garnish with fresh parsley.

Notes

  • For extra flavor, marinate the chicken in the glaze for 30 minutes before baking.
  • Use chicken thighs if you prefer darker meat; adjust baking time slightly.
  • Serve this dish over rice, quinoa, or with a fresh green salad.
